  1. If you were having difficulty on an important test and could safely cheat by looking at someone else’s paper, would you do so?  To be completely honest, I would be tempted, but I would not cheat.
  2. Since adolescence, in what three-year period do you feel you experienced the most personal growth and change?  I would have to say the three-year period from mid-1999 through mid-2002.  In that period, I got married to my lovely wife, graduated from seminary, moved and started my first full-time ministry job, and experienced the birth of our first child.  Those events all involved lots of change and personal growth.  I went from being on my own to being part of a committed, covenant relationship, and then to being responsible for raising a child.  I grew into my calling as a minister and this period of my life was the beginning of much maturation (still far from completion) on my part.
  3. If you could change one thing about your home, what would you like to change?  I would add another full bath.  I live with my lovely wife and three beautiful daughters in a house with one full bath and one half bath.  Another full bath would be wonderful (for all of us)! 
  4. If you were given a yacht today, what would you name it?  Abundant Blessings
